24.(1) The Minister may appoint a central advisory committee for any profession or professions engaged in the provision of services under this Order or for a particular service provided under this Order, and may, at any time after consultation with that committee, dissolve that committee. (2) A central advisory committee shall advise the Council, or if in a particular case the Ministry so directs, the Ministry, on the provision of any service with which that committee is concerned. (3) The Council shall consult with any such central advisory committee on such occasions and to such extent as may be determined by the Ministry, and may ask the committee to undertake, on behalf of the Council, such investigation as the Council thinks fit. (4) A central advisory committee shall consist of a chairman appointed by the Minister and such other members as the Minister may consider necessary, appointed after consultation with such interests as appear to the Minister to be concerned; and the Minister may at any time appoint an additional member or fill a vacancy created by the death or resignation of a member. (5) A central advisory committee may appoint sub-committees, whether jointly with another central advisory committee or otherwise, and may appoint to such sub-committees persons who are not members of the central advisory committee or committees concerned. (6) A central advisory committee may regulate its own quorum and procedure.
